- The distance between Pensacola, Fl, Usa and Pana, Il, Usa is approximately 1,005 km or 625 mi.
- To reach Pensacola, Fl in this distance one would set out from Pana, Il bearing 169.5° or S and follow the great circles arc to approach Pensacola, Fl bearing 170.6° or S .
- Pensacola, Fl has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Pana, Il has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a).
- The mean annual temperature is 8.1 °C (14.6°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 10.2 °C (18.4°F) less in Pensacola, Fl.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 560.3 mm (22.1 in) more which is equivalent to 560.3 l/m² (13.75 US gal/ft²) or 5,603,000 l/ha (598,998 US gal/ac) more. About 1 5/9 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 8.9° higher in Pensacola, Fl than in Pana, Il.
